At the time of MEC MTech admission, aspirants are admitted based on the sanctioned seat intake. The seats available for each M.Tech specialisation is mentioned in the following table:
| MTech Specialisation | Seat Intake |
|---|---|
| VLSI Design and Embedded Engineering | 24 |
| Mechanical Engineering (Energy Management) | 18 |
| Computer Science Engineering (Data Science) | 18 |

In 2023, MEC Kochi has been ranked #37 by India Today in the Engineering category. No recent ranking data is available for the college. However, in 2021, NIRF ranked it #279. It was also among the top six NIRF-Ranked colleges in Kerala in 2021.

MEC Kochi BTech course admission is entrance-based. The admission process involves application form filling, shortlisting of students based on KEAM score, and seat allotment. A cutoff list is released after conclusion of application procedure to declare minimum score required in examination for a candidate to become eligible for selection. Once selected, aspirants need to pay a course fee to confirm their seat in the college.

Modern Engineering College has not mentioned clearly whether it accepts the applications on the college website or not. Aspirants seeking admission in BTech need to fill out the KEAM application form. The process to apply for KEAM is to complete the KEAM registration by filling out the basic details and creating an application number and password to login at various stages of admission. For MTech, aspirants need to apply on the official website of DTE Kerala.

MEC Kochi BTech is offered in seven specialisations. All the courses are offered in a full-time mode. Table below carries names of the specialisations:
| MEC Kochi BTech Specialisations | ||
|---|---|---|
| Computer Science and Engineering | Electronics and Communication | Electrical and Electronics |
| Electronics and Biomedical Engineering | Mechanical Engineering | Computer Science and Business Systems Engineering |
| Electronics (VLSI Design and Technology) | Electrical & Electronics Engineering for Working Professionals | Electronics & Communication Engineering for Working Professionals |

MEC Kochi has not released a separate placement report for BTech as of now. However, as per an overall report, the highest package offered in the 2022 placement drive was above INR 32 LPA. A total of 416 offers were made. Moreover, the top recuiters in the placement drive were Myntra, Google, and Capgemini.

Amrita College of Nursing Kochi offers a two-year course of MSc Nursing across four specialisations. Find them below:
- Medical Surgical Nursing
- Child Health Nursing
- Mental Health Nursing
- Obstetric and Gynecological Nursing

For admission to MSc at Amrita College of Nursing Kochi, students are required to fulfill the minimum eligibility criteria in the first place to apply for admission. Find below the qualification requirements for MSc at Amrita College of Nursing Kochi:
- Pass graduation in BSc/ BSc (Hons)/ Post Basic BSc Nursing with a minimum 50% aggregate from a recognised university by the Indian Nursing Council
- One year of work experience will be considered for candidates with Post Baisc BSc Nursing.
- Candidate should be a registered Nurse and Midwife with State Nursing Council.
- Candidate must be medically fit.
